    I think when you turn the toes over and hit more with your heel at the end of the kick (side teep/ thai sidekick) you generate more power because you utilise your glutes more

    • @lYakuzal
      @lYakuzal 3 года назад +7

      Yes it does generate more power, but side teeps requires some load up and can be risky to throw out.
      Front teep is a great technique because of the balance and fast recovery. Teeping is like a jab, it's quick and non-telegraphed as it is a technique to keep your opponent at bay. You also will be able to return to your stance quickly since you're just moving your front leg straight forward and back, so you can throw it again or defend right after
